Roof weatherproofing services involve applying protective coatings or sealants to a roof’s surface to prevent water intrusion and damage. These treatments create a barrier that helps keep rain, snow, and moisture from penetrating the roofing materials, which can otherwise lead to leaks, mold growth, and structural deterioration. Weatherproofing is often performed on existing roofs to enhance their resistance to weather elements without the need for a full roof replacement. Properly weatherproofed roofs can contribute to the longevity of the roofing system and reduce the likelihood of costly repairs caused by water-related issues.
Many common roofing problems can be addressed or prevented through weatherproofing services. For example, aging roofs with cracks, worn-out sealants, or minor damage can benefit from a protective coating that restores their ability to repel water. This service can also help mitigate issues caused by recurring leaks, ice dams, or moisture buildup in attic spaces. Homeowners who notice water stains on ceilings, increased energy bills due to poor insulation, or signs of roof wear may find that weatherproofing offers a practical solution to extend the life of their roof and improve overall property protection.
Weatherproofing is suitable for a variety of property types, including residential homes, multi-family buildings, and small commercial properties. Single-family houses with aging or damaged roofs are common candidates, especially those in regions experiencing frequent storms or heavy rainfall. Additionally, properties with flat or low-slope roofs often require specialized weatherproofing solutions to prevent water pooling and leaks. The overview below groups typical Roof Weatherproofing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or weatherproofing fixes like sealing leaks or patching small areas,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the work needed.
Moderate Projects - Mid-sized weatherproofing tasks, such as re-coating or adding protective layers, generally cost between $600 and $2,000. These projects are common and often involve larger roof sections or multiple areas.
Roof Coatings and Sealants - Applying specialized coatings or sealants to improve weather resistance usually ranges from $1,000 to $3,500. Many local service providers handle projects in this band, with fewer reaching the upper end.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ete roof weatherproofing or replacement can vary widely, typically from $5,000 to $15,000 or more for larger, more complex projects. Such extensive work is less common but necessary for severe damage or aging roofs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
